Pancakes
1 ripe banana
1 egg, room temp
1/2 tbsp cashew butter
Coconut oil
Topping
Pomegranate
Mixed berries
1 tsp cashew butter
Spoonful Greek yogurt (optional)
Sprinkle coconut palm sugar, if desired
Method
(Serves one)
1. Mash the banana together with the cashew butter, and whisk in the egg
2. Heat the coconut oil, spoon three dollops of mixture in and cook for a couple of minutes on either side, until golden brown
3, Add toppings as desired. EASY!
